3. Reverdy C. Ransom, How Should the Christian State Deal with the Race Problem? An Address Delivered by Rev. Reverdy C. Ransom, D. D[,] October 3, 1905, Before the National Reform Convention in the Park Street Congregational Church, Boston, Mass. ([Boston?]: n.p., [1905?]). ([5] p.)
Address in which the speaker argues that “there should be no race problem in the Christian state.”
